The IIT Mumbai has declared the JEE Advanced 2022 results in the morning today. ALLEN students Mahit Gadhiwala have bagged 9th AIR & Deevyanshu Malu secures 11th AIR in JEE Advanced 2022 results.  A total number of 155538 candidates appeared in both papers 1 and 2 in JEE (Advanced) 2022. A total of 40712 candidates have qualified JEE (Advanced) 2022. Of the total qualified candidates, 6516 are females. Toppers from Allen here have revealed their success mantra in JEE Advanced 2022.

Mahit Gadhiwala has secured All India Rank 9th in JEE Advanced-2022. Mahit has been Allen’s classroom student for the last seven years. Mahit has been the Gujarat State Topper in JEE Main 2022 with All India Rank-29. Apart from this, in the same year, he passed class 12th with 98.6 percent marks. Mahit has secured Black Belt Den-2 in the competition organized by The World Taekwondo Headquarters, South Korea. Mahit told that I want to be an engineer. I got success due to my hard work and coaching at Allen. The dream of becoming an IITian is going to be realized soon. After the last seven years of preparation with ALLEN, I have been able to crack JEE Advanced. Allen’s environment is positive and motivating. I focused more on revision, and doubt solving with daily homework since JEE Advanced paper is challenging. To solve such papers, preparation has to be done at the same level. Therefore, more and more practice for solving the questions should be done. Time management and accuracy also have to be taken care of. Apart from classroom study, I used to do self-study for 7-8 hours a day.

Deevyanshu Malu, a resident of Bhubaneswar, Odisha has secured All India Rank 11.  Earlier, in the JEE Main June session, Deevyanshu had topped Odisha State by scoring 99.99 percentile.  Deevyanshu is a classroom student at ALLEN for the last three years.  Deevyanshu told that I do self-study for 7-8 hours daily. Sometimes, I used to do self-analysis if the marks were less in the test and avoid repeating those mistakes in the next test.  I believe mistakes are meant to be improved but they should not be repeated, and one should learn from them.  At present, the target is to do a B.Tech from IIT Mumbai.  After joining Allen, I improved a lot.  Since the basics were clear from the beginning so there was no problem in further studies.  Faculties always explained what to study, how to study, and how much to study.  Instead of reading unnecessary study material, the aspirant is more benefited if he only reads the study material provided by the institute.  Passed class 12th with 97.6 percent marks, while got 97 percent marks in class 10th.  Won Gold Medal in International Physics Olympiad and Silver Medal in Asian Physics Olympiad.  Apart from this, got an All India Rank 5 in KVPY SX.
